Summary


On April 14, 2021, Sumter County Fire Department responded to a hazmat incident at 370 Pack Rd, Sumter, SC 29150, a 1-or-2 family dwelling.

The alarm was received at 9:04 PM, 2 suppression and 7 other personnel arrived at 9:08 PM, and the last unit was cleared at 9:34 PM. The time to arrive was 4 minutes and the total incident time was 30 minutes.

The following action was taken during the incident: investigate.
